About the role

  • Manage and oversee engineering and design aspects of mineral processing engineering projects, including conceptual design, feasibility studies and detailed engineering for the disciplines of Civil, Structural, Mechanical, Piping, Electrical and Instrumentation.
  • Lead a multidisciplinary team of engineers and designers, primarily providing technical expertise as well as guidance and mentorship to ensure project objectives are met.
  • Be responsible for technical approval and sign-off of the project's engineering and design.
  • Collaborate with the Functional Managers (Mechanical / Civil & Structural / Electrical and Instrumentation) to ensure positive project outcomes from a technical and schedule perspective.
  • Collaborate with clients to understand their requirements, develop project scopes, and deliver customized solutions that meet or exceed expectations.
  • Ensure compliance with relevant regulatory requirements, industry standards, and company policies, with a strong focus on health, safety, and environmental stewardship.
  • Foster a culture of continuous improvement and knowledge sharing within the team, promoting innovation, excellence, and professional development.

About you

  • A Bachelor's degree; Mechanical, Civil, Structural or Electrical Engineering.
  • Extensive experience with discipline engineering within a mineral processing EPCM environment, with proven experience in a leadership role.
  • Strong technical expertise in mineral processing principles, technologies, and equipment.
  • Proven track record of successfully managing complex engineering projects from concept to completion, with a focus on safety, technical quality, and client satisfaction.
  • Excellent leadership, communication, and interpersonal skills, with the ability to effectively manage teams and collaborate with clients and stakeholders.
  • Proficiency in project management tools and methodologies, with a strong emphasis on planning, scheduling, and budgeting.
  • Knowledge of relevant regulatory requirements, industry standards, and best practices.
  • Commitment to professional development and staying abreast of industry trends and advancements.
